Description: David Fincher is young, talented, and something of an outsider, with a dark cinematic vision from the serial-killer drama "Seven" to the urban gothic thriller "Panic Room," In "Dark Eye," written with Fincher's full involvement and featuring in-depth interviews, journalist James Swallow presents a complete survey of the director's work. He begins with Fincher's early career at special-effects house Industrial Light & Magic, where he worked on films like "Return of the Jedi" and "Indiana Jones and the Temple of Doom," He then looks at each of the director's major films, including his most recent release, "Zodiac," Rounding out the book is a reference section and website listing.
